  • What is a subscription?
    Within the subscription contract you have access to our SAMBA+ executable packages for Enterprise Linux that we derived from the free public Samba sources. This access is available for 1,2 or 3 years and is valid for 5 servers, regardless the CPU number and other hardware specifications, virtualized or on bare metal.

  • How do I activate a new SAMBA+ subscription?
    Please follow these four steps to activate a new SAMBA+ subscription: 
    1. Purchase a SAMBA+ subscription in this online shop,
    2. copy subscription key from your user account under "serial numbers",
    3. create customer account in the subscription portal OPOSSO,
    4. paste subscription key from the OPOSSO portal under "new subscription" and set a password.

  • How do I extend an existing SAMBA+ subscription?
    Please follow these three steps to renew an existing SAMBA+ subscription: 
    1. Purchase a SAMBA+ subscription in this online shop,  
    2. copy subscription key in your user account under "serial numbers",
    3. paste subscription key in the subscription portal OPOSSO under "extend selected subscriptions".

  • What happens when the subscription expires?
    Samba is free software licensed unter GPLv3 and higher. After downloading the software you are free to own, to use, and to modify the software. Please refer to our terms and conditions for detailed explanation.

  • Is there any support included?
    No. Subscription means access to the software and any updates and upgrades during the duration of the contract. Additional Samba support is available worldwide, refer to https://www.samba.org/samba/support/. Information about SerNet's support offerings are available right here.
